What is telemarketing?

Telemarketing is a form of direct marketing where sales representatives contact potential or existing customers by telephone to promote products, services, or gather information. Telemarketers may work in call centers or remotely, making outbound calls or handling inbound inquiries. The goal is typically to generate sales, set appointments, or collect survey data. Telemarketing requires strong communication skills and the ability to handle rejection professionally.

What are some common challenges faced by telemarketers and how can they be addressed?

Telemarketers often encounter challenges such as frequent rejection, maintaining motivation, and meeting sales targets. Overcoming these hurdles involves developing strong communication skills, resilience, and the ability to quickly adapt to different customer responses. Many organizations provide regular training, support from team leaders, and scripts to help manage difficult calls. Additionally, telemarketers typically collaborate closely with sales and marketing teams, which fosters a supportive environment and opportunities for skill development.

How do I get a job as a telemarketer?

To get a job as a telemarketer, you should have good communication skills, a persuasive voice, and the ability to handle rejection. Many positions require a high school diploma or equivalent, and some employers provide training on sales techniques and scripts. Applying through job boards, company websites, or staffing agencies can help you find openings in this field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Telemarketer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Telemarketer, you need excellent verbal communication skills, persuasive sales abilities,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software and call center phone systems is typically required. Resilience, active listening, and a positive attitude help telemarketers handle rejection and build rapport with potential customers. These skills and qualities are crucial for meeting sales targets, maintaining customer satisfaction, and succeeding in a competitive sales environment.
